This dataset includes 700 completed interviews from Mozambique following Cyclone Idai, including respondents from Sofala province and Beira. All respondents were affected by the cyclone, and data includes information on home and community damages, food security, and access to resources including clean water and electricity. Data was collected via remote SMS survey March 21st, 2019 - March 22nd 2019 and is not nationally or regionally representative but is intended to show a snapshot of the cyclone's impact on the ground. Statistical disclosure control methods have been applied to the data in order to protect individual respondents information.
